A CONVICTED rapist with links to East Lancashire is wanted by police on recall to prison after allegedly breaching his licence conditions.
Police said 63-year-old Francis Doherty, also known as Frank Doherty, has links to Rawtenstall, Bacup and Haslingden.

Police said Doherty, who was jailed for three years in May 2005 after being convicted of two sexual assaults and was jailed in 1985 after being convicted of rape, is wanted for breach of his licence conditions.
Doherty, who is on the sex offender’s register for life and first committed a sexual offence 38 years ago, could be sleeping rough and begging in the Manchester area, police said.
Temporary Detective Sergeant Stephen Munro said: “We are appealing for information as to Doherty’s whereabouts after he breached his licence conditions.
“From our enquiries we believe Doherty knows he is now wanted and could be hiding in the Greater Manchester area.
“It is possible Doherty could be begging but unknown where and he may be sleeping rough.
“Anyone with information which may assist our enquiries is asked to contact police immediately on 101, quoting log reference 0030 of October 15."
